1 /*
2   This is a maximally equidistributed combined Tausworthe generator
3   based on code from GNU Scientific Library 1.5 (30 Jun 2004)
4 
5   lfsr113 version:
6 
7    x_n = (s1_n ^ s2_n ^ s3_n ^ s4_n)
8 
9    s1_{n+1} = (((s1_n & 4294967294) << 18) ^ (((s1_n <<  6) ^ s1_n) >> 13))
10    s2_{n+1} = (((s2_n & 4294967288) <<  2) ^ (((s2_n <<  2) ^ s2_n) >> 27))
11    s3_{n+1} = (((s3_n & 4294967280) <<  7) ^ (((s3_n << 13) ^ s3_n) >> 21))
12    s4_{n+1} = (((s4_n & 4294967168) << 13) ^ (((s4_n <<  3) ^ s4_n) >> 12))
13 
14    The period of this generator is about 2^113 (see erratum paper).
15 
16    From: P. L'Ecuyer, "Maximally Equidistributed Combined Tausworthe
17    Generators", Mathematics of Computation, 65, 213 (1996), 203--213:
18    http://www.iro.umontreal.ca/~lecuyer/myftp/papers/tausme.ps
19    ftp://ftp.iro.umontreal.ca/pub/simulation/lecuyer/papers/tausme.ps
20 
21    There is an erratum in the paper "Tables of Maximally
22    Equidistributed Combined LFSR Generators", Mathematics of
23    Computation, 68, 225 (1999), 261--269:
24    http://www.iro.umontreal.ca/~lecuyer/myftp/papers/tausme2.ps
25 
26         ... the k_j most significant bits of z_j must be non-
27         zero, for each j. (Note: this restriction also applies to the
28         computer code given in [4], but was mistakenly not mentioned in
29         that paper.)
30 
31    This affects the seeding procedure by imposing the requirement
32    s1 > 1, s2 > 7, s3 > 15, s4 > 127.
33 
34 */

49 /**
50  *	prandom_u32_state - seeded pseudo-random number generator.
51  *	@state: pointer to state structure holding seeded state.
52  *
53  *	This is used for pseudo-randomness with no outside seeding.
54  *	For more random results, use prandom_u32().
55  */
56 u32 prandom_u32_state(struct rnd_state *state)
57 {
58 #define TAUSWORTHE(s,a,b,c,d) ((s&c)<<d) ^ (((s <<a) ^ s)>>b)
59 
60 	state->s1 = TAUSWORTHE(state->s1,  6U, 13U, 4294967294U, 18U);
61 	state->s2 = TAUSWORTHE(state->s2,  2U, 27U, 4294967288U,  2U);
62 	state->s3 = TAUSWORTHE(state->s3, 13U, 21U, 4294967280U,  7U);
63 	state->s4 = TAUSWORTHE(state->s4,  3U, 12U, 4294967168U, 13U);
64 
65 	return (state->s1 ^ state->s2 ^ state->s3 ^ state->s4);
66 }
67 EXPORT_SYMBOL(prandom_u32_state);
68 
69 /**
70  *	prandom_u32 - pseudo random number generator
71  *
72  *	A 32 bit pseudo-random number is generated using a fast
73  *	algorithm suitable for simulation. This algorithm is NOT
74  *	considered safe for cryptographic use.
75  */
76 u32 prandom_u32(void)
77 {
78 	unsigned long r;
79 	struct rnd_state *state = &get_cpu_var(net_rand_state);
80 	r = prandom_u32_state(state);
81 	put_cpu_var(state);
82 	return r;
83 }
84 EXPORT_SYMBOL(prandom_u32);

135 static void prandom_warmup(struct rnd_state *state)
136 {
137 	/* Calling RNG ten times to satify recurrence condition */
138 	prandom_u32_state(state);
139 	prandom_u32_state(state);
140 	prandom_u32_state(state);
141 	prandom_u32_state(state);
142 	prandom_u32_state(state);
143 	prandom_u32_state(state);
144 	prandom_u32_state(state);
145 	prandom_u32_state(state);
146 	prandom_u32_state(state);
147 	prandom_u32_state(state);
148 }
149 
150 static void prandom_seed_very_weak(struct rnd_state *state, u32 seed)
151 {
152 	/* Note: This sort of seeding is ONLY used in test cases and
153 	 * during boot at the time from core_initcall until late_initcall
154 	 * as we don't have a stronger entropy source available yet.
155 	 * After late_initcall, we reseed entire state, we have to (!),
156 	 * otherwise an attacker just needs to search 32 bit space to
157 	 * probe for our internal 128 bit state if he knows a couple
158 	 * of prandom32 outputs!
159 	 */
160 #define LCG(x)	((x) * 69069U)	/* super-duper LCG */
161 	state->s1 = __seed(LCG(seed),        2U);
162 	state->s2 = __seed(LCG(state->s1),   8U);
163 	state->s3 = __seed(LCG(state->s2),  16U);
164 	state->s4 = __seed(LCG(state->s3), 128U);
165 }

232 /*
233  *	Generate better values after random number generator
234  *	is fully initialized.
235  */
236 static void __prandom_reseed(bool late)
237 {
238 	int i;
239 	unsigned long flags;
240 	static bool latch = false;
241 	static DEFINE_SPINLOCK(lock);
242 
243 	/* only allow initial seeding (late == false) once */
244 	spin_lock_irqsave(&lock, flags);
245 	if (latch && !late)
246 		goto out;
247 	latch = true;
248 
249 	for_each_possible_cpu(i) {
250 		struct rnd_state *state = &per_cpu(net_rand_state,i);
251 		u32 seeds[4];
252 
253 		get_random_bytes(&seeds, sizeof(seeds));
254 		state->s1 = __seed(seeds[0],   2U);
255 		state->s2 = __seed(seeds[1],   8U);
256 		state->s3 = __seed(seeds[2],  16U);
257 		state->s4 = __seed(seeds[3], 128U);
258 
259 		prandom_warmup(state);
260 	}
261 out:
262 	spin_unlock_irqrestore(&lock, flags);
263 }
